Submission Categories

Paper presentations can be submitted presenting research results or reviews of existing results including empirical or theoretical studies, policy reviews, comprehensive case studies, and presentation of project results, if they are in their conclusive phase.

Posters are welcome about work-in-progress, achievements of initial research, projects in early stages of development, case studies, etc. Poster presentations will be themed and moderated in related sessions and published in the Proceedings.

A limited number of workshops ? introducing a comprehensive theme from different perspectives, focused sessions on a particular topic, debates, discussions ? are invited. Priority will be given to workshop submissions which foresee integrated virtual participation (organised by the authors) via webinars.

Please note that the workshop category is usually rather competitive.

Demonstrations can showcase practical innovations, products, technologies and tools, to encourage the early exhibition of prototypes, focusing on user experience. They will offer opportunity to show and discuss, to exchange ideas and collect feedback from expert users.

Synergy Strand

EDEN resumes its newest collaboration initiative. Take advantage of this special format and the prospect of meeting fellow project managers and researchers and share and discuss your EU projects and initiatives – preferably that display thematic cross sections with the Conference Themes – with your peers in the frame of the Synergy Strand.

If your initiative is not mature enough to be presented as a comprehensive research paper but has potential for development and could benefit from peer discussion and networking, we highly recommend you to submit in this category.

The Synergy Strand in Barcelona will facilitate the sharing of project outputs and research findings, offer the participants platform to develop new ideas and plans, to create new partnerships by engaging the conference audience in highly interactive working group activities during parallel sessions.

The Synergy contributions will not be subjected to the same rigorous academic peer review as paper submissions but their acceptance will be also decided by experts from the Programme Committee. Aspects of evaluation include the relevance, level of elaboration of the initiative and quality of presentation.

The short pre-formatted introductions will be published in the Creative Commons licensed Book of Projects.

Selection

Evaluation of submissions is done by double peer-review. Decisions on acceptance will be based on originality, innovation and quality of contribution, on the proposal?s relevance to the conference themes, further the proven experience of the author(s). Contributions not matching the conference themes will meanwhile also be considered if they bring new knowledge and benefit to delegates.

Young Scholars Support

We are pleased to announce that EDEN’s support scheme to young scholars will be offered at the 2015 Annual Conference, following up the Young Researchers’ Scheme introduced in 2014 in Oxford thanks to the Ulrich Bernath Foundation and the Oldenburg University.

Two young researchers‘ attendance at the Conference will be supported with ?600 each and waived fee. (For young scholars, full time students and PhD students (under 35 years) a special discounted registration fee of 200 ? is offered.) The colleagues awarded should have a submission (paper or poster) accepted for presentation at the Conference.
Conditions:
– author of an accepted paper or poster submission,
– full time regular or PhD student under 35 years and
– sending the evidence on the student status and the applicant’s age to the Conference Secretariat  by 15 February.
